Meet the Client

Henna and Gavin envisioned a wedding that was modern, elegant, and timeless, perfectly complementing their venue, The Glass Factory in Jacksonville. This historic space, built in 1936 by Henry Klutho, provided an industrial aesthetic with its exposed brick and towering windows, serving as the ideal backdrop for their clean, neutral color palette. Their goal was to create a sophisticated event that felt upscale and classy while remaining approachable and memorable for their guests.

The FOCUS

To bring their vision to life, we designed a cohesive stationery package tailored to every aspect of their wedding. The suite featured invitations, save-the-dates, and RSVP cards, all utilizing delicate typography and a minimalist design approach. Additional elements included programs, custom signage, hotel welcome cards, and charming donut boxes for favors, adding a personalized touch to the celebration. Every detail was carefully crafted to reflect their vision, resulting in a unified and elegant design that seamlessly tied together their modern wedding at this one-of-a-kind venue.

The final creation was a cohesive and refined design suite that seamlessly captured the couples vision, elevating the modern elegance of their wedding and highlighting the venue’s unique character
